Initiatives and Innovations

Reducing Single-Use Plastics

One of the most significant steps in the fight against plastic pollution is the reduction of single-use plastics. Many countries have banned or restricted plastic bags, straws, and utensils, encouraging the use of eco-friendly alternatives.

Recycling and Circular Economy

The promotion of recycling and the development of a circular economy are key strategies. Turning plastic waste into new products reduces the demand for virgin plastic production.

The Role of Technology

Innovative Cleanup Solutions

Technology plays a pivotal role in addressing plastic pollution. Innovations like ocean-cleaning robots and plastic-eating enzymes are helping to remove existing plastic waste from our environment.

Plastic Alternatives

Scientists are also developing alternative materials that mimic plastic's convenience but biodegrade harmlessly. These breakthroughs promise to reduce our reliance on traditional plastics.
